u/Sensitive_Square3645 Jun 04 '26

Oh mb, when I searched up "icon composer app store" on Google, I didn't really check the link, but just did and turns out that's a fake one... 😬

Apologies for not really doing my research. But anyway, you can download the real Icon Composer here. But yea you can just download the standalone app directly, and you actually do not need Xcode. Oh and don't worry it should be there, just scroll down. Also I should have been more specific because you actually need at least Sequoia 15.3 or higher. 15.0-15.2 will not work.
